THIS is when I make it fun by trying different things with the quilting such as trying new stitches or experimenting with FMQ... you could also create a really cool label for it or come up with something different to do with the backing or make it into a quillow. Add a piece of fabric origami to the front or back. Anything that makes it FUN again. Quilting is supposed to be fun according to the way I look at it.
